Transaction 66a59a5f5977c593c38c6a62cf900d27636fb92d7d6408c173a500055c5d4d02

1 Input
2 Outputs
  • 66a59a5f5977c593c38c6a62cf900d27636fb92d7d6408c173a500055c5d4d02:0
  • value  116870000
    address  1LPCqZpD5H4ZaSU1qioHD7Mbau4AvCT3kn
  • 66a59a5f5977c593c38c6a62cf900d27636fb92d7d6408c173a500055c5d4d02:1
  • value  15109829140
    address  3LLbnADR4Wf3PZkZfc9kz1pCFPtBA6xApc